diff options
Diffstat (limited to 'libraries/Botan/Botan.SlackBuild')
-rw-r--r-- | libraries/Botan/Botan.SlackBuild | 29 |
1 files changed, 20 insertions, 9 deletions
diff --git a/libraries/Botan/Botan.SlackBuild b/libraries/Botan/Botan.SlackBuild index 2d048dbd9d1ce..c124ecc55f722 100644 --- a/libraries/Botan/Botan.SlackBuild +++ b/libraries/Botan/Botan.SlackBuild @@ -24,14 +24,18 @@ # SUCH DAMAGE. # # markus reichelt, slackbuilds@mareichelt.de, 0xCCEEF115 -# 2010 June 22 - initial release -# 2011 August 28 - adapted to v1.8.13 +# 2010 Jun 22 - initial release +# 2011 Aug 28 - adapted to Botan-1.8.13 +# 2011 Sep 07 - adapted to Botan-1.10.1 PRGNAM=Botan -VERSION=${VERSION:-1.8.13} +VERSION=${VERSION:-1.10.1} BUILD=${BUILD:-1} TAG=${TAG:-_SBo} +#this kludge is required, courtesy of upstream +PRGNAMI=botan + if [ -z "$ARCH" ]; then case "$( uname -m )" in i?86) ARCH=i486 ;; @@ -80,11 +84,10 @@ CXXFLAGS="$SLKCFLAGS" \ ./configure.py \ --prefix=/usr \ --docdir=doc \ - --libdir=lib$LIBDIRSUFFIX + --libdir=lib$LIBDIRSUFFIX \ + --with-doxygen make -make check -make doxygen make install DESTDIR=$PKG/usr find $PKG | xargs file | grep -e "executable" -e "shared object" | grep ELF \ @@ -94,9 +97,17 @@ find $PKG | xargs file | grep -e "executable" -e "shared object" | grep ELF \ find doc -type d -exec chmod 0755 {} \; find doc -type f -exec chmod 0644 {} \; -cp -a doc/doxygen/html doc/examples doc/scripts \ - $PKG/usr/doc/$PRGNAM-$VERSION -cat $CWD/$PRGNAM.SlackBuild > $PKG/usr/doc/$PRGNAM-$VERSION/$PRGNAM.SlackBuild +mv $PKG/usr/doc/$PRGNAMI-$VERSION/doxygen/ $PKG/usr/doc/$PRGNAMI-$VERSION/html/ + +cp -a \ + doc/examples/ \ + $PKG/usr/doc/$PRGNAMI-$VERSION/ + +cp -a \ + doc/*.el \ + $PKG/usr/doc/$PRGNAMI-$VERSION/manual/ + +cat $CWD/$PRGNAM.SlackBuild > $PKG/usr/doc/$PRGNAMI-$VERSION/$PRGNAM.SlackBuild mkdir -p $PKG/install cat $CWD/slack-desc > $PKG/install/slack-desc |